"To fully appreciate the crescendo of our own existence, we must sometimes embrace moments of silence. Such is the symphony of life." ~~~ Liu Xinyu has always lived by one motto: "Never give up." Despite facing numerous setbacks and challenges in life, she has persevered, always looking ahead with unwavering determination. However, after a life-altering accident leaves her feeling exhausted and adrift, she begins to question the purpose behind her relentless pursuit. In search of clarity and meaning, Liu Xinyu finds herself inexplicably transported more than two decades into the past, a time when her parents were young and unmarried. Looking at her young parents who looked more like enemies than lovers, Liu Xinyu felt like everything she knew was a lie. Stuck in the past, Liu Xinyu has to navigate the complexities of her parents' past and the implications it holds for her own identity. Join Liu Xinyu as she embarks on a journey to the past filled with mysteries and untold secrets. She must confront the long-buried family secrets, reconcile her conflicting emotions, and ultimately find the strength to redefine her sense of self and purpose along with a fanciful crime partner. "Tingting?" repeated Liu Xinyu.

Yi Qin looked at her and smiled softly when he answered, "Zhang Yating. My girlfriend. My love. Do you know, we were an envious couple in high school."

"Your high school allows dating?" asked Liu Xinyu with a strange tone.

"No, they don't. But we weren't dating at that time either. In fact, it was only after graduation that I asked her out. However, even if we weren't dating in high school, we were pretty close. Everyone could see that we both had feelings for each other but we wanted to focus on school too. That was such a sweet time," he seemed to be reminiscing about the time he spent in high school. "Since neither of us poked through the paper window, there was some ambiguity between us too. I quite enjoyed that period of time. We made so many memories together. Even if those memories were made as just friends, they are very precious to me."

"Those memories are precious because now, the times have changed," was Liu Xinyu's very unbiased opinion. In fact, she was very casual about seeing her young father being in love with another woman. After coming to terms with the fact that she time-traveled to the past rather than an alternate reality, one thing was confirmed. This was the past of her parents. 

So, even if she did nothing and stayed still, her parents would still end up together. She had to do literally nothing. She didn't think she was sent here with the mission of making her parents fall in love. That was a joke!

She was also a girl from the modern era, and being in that era, it was impossible not to come across novels or dramas with the theme of transmigration, rebirth, or even time-traveling. Liu Xinyu who wasn't really a big consumer of this genre, still had some ideas. For instance, she could remember a drama she watched where the protagonist never knew who his father was so one day after an accident, he found himself in the past and found that his young mother had two suitors. It was up to him to find out who was really his father between the two.

There was another drama where the protagonist went back to the past to fix the broken marriage of his parents. 

Liu Xinyu did not have such purposes. Why change the past when she didn't think that the future was bad? Yes, she was lost but that was her own problem, right? What did it have to do with the past of her parents? She wasn't even a part of this past, so how could it really affect her?

That's why Liu Xinyu was being very open-minded about her father's first love. If he didn't go through this experience, how would he become her father in the future? She'd like to keep her distance from her parents' story until or unless something threatens her future existence.

"Times have really changed now," was Yi Qin's response as he looked at the wristband he wore with a complicated look in his eyes. "We aren't ignorant kids anymore. We have to work on our futures."

"Have you ever envisioned your future?" asked Liu Xinyu. "What does it look like in your mind?"

Yi Qin smiled happily as he shared with her, "I want to design a house and then I'd propose to Yating. My draft is almost done. I'll show it to Yating on her birthday to make her happy. She is working really hard these days, there is a high chance she'll be promoted by the end of the year. I'll propose to her on her promotion day. I'll throw her a party and call all her colleagues and friends and propose to her right in front of them. We'd have a grand wedding. I have already picked out the wedding dress designer. It's a famous designer from Italy. She makes the most gorgeous wedding gowns. I think my Tingting will look amazing in a wedding dress. Oh, we should have two kids because one would be too lonely. One boy and one girl. I don't mind both girls too. I'd support her so that she can excel in her career and achieve everything she wants. We will have a small but warm family."

Okay, it seemed Liu Xinyu was not as open-minded about her young father's first love as she was convincing herself to be. Just listening to his expectations about their future together made her so uncomfortable. She clenched her hand under the table as she forced a smile on her face. 

It took her a moment to calm down before she spoke again, "And where are you in that future?"

"Huh?" Yi Qin was dumbfounded by her question. "Aren't I there? I just told you."

"Your vision of the future is all about Zhang Yating. Her career, her happiness, her comfort, her likes, her dislikes, everything is about her. I don't see you there. Isn't it, your future? Why are you taking the backstage then?"

"Why does it matter?" he asked strangely. "As long as my partner is happy, I am happy."

"I understand it now," said Liu Xinyu.

"What?"

"You're too accommodating," answered Liu Xinyu. "Rather than putting yourself first, you like to put the person you love first. Nothing is wrong with that. But, from what you earlier said, I understood one thing clearly. While you are placing Zhang Yating first, is she also giving you the same place in her heart or in her life? Because I don't see it that way. It's good to be understanding of your partner, but sometimes, it's not that good to be understanding either. Isn't it making you already feel uncomfortable that your girlfriend didn't understand you? I believe the reason you came back early today was because she had more important things to do than to spend time with you. You, who is not ambitious enough. You, who is just daydreaming like a child rather than focusing on your career."

Those words really struck a chord and it really hurt Yi Qin. He didn't think he said too much but somehow, she was able to see everything very clearly. He didn't know what he was feeling right now at being seen through like this. He always got prickly when Nan Xing saw through his thoughts but he couldn't even muster a little bit of that frustration around Liu Xinyu.

"I don't think I'm doing anything wrong though," he mumbled in a small voice.

Liu Xinyu raised her brows at his behavior before nodding her head, "As long as you are happy. My opinions or others don't matter. It's your life. Whether it's good or bad, only you'd know." She took a pause before adding, "But there is a famous saying where I come from. We as humans tend to choose a familiar hell over an unfamiliar heaven. Because a familiar hell is comfortable. So what if it's just a vicious cycle consuming our vitality slowly? As long as we feel safe in that hell, nothing else matters."

Yi Qin went silent and drank his coffee in silence while pondering her words over and over again in his head. Although he believed her words were true, he still felt like those words had nothing to do with him. He wasn't stuck in a vicious cycle. He could never be.

Thinking of something, he looked up at her again and asked, "What about you? What does your future look like in your mind?"

"Mine?" she repeated as she tilted her head a little. "It's blank."

"What?"

"It's blank," she answered him. "My future had always been like a blank piece of paper. My father says, why focus on the future when you can live in the present? Rather than wasting time thinking about the unknown future, I'd rather focus on writing my present. So, today... No, this very moment is all I know. I'm just living in this moment. Just a while ago, I didn't think I'd be sitting here eating a cake but aren't I here? Just like that, I don't know what I'd be doing next. I never made too elaborate plans in life. If I did that, I'd have really been stuck in the quagmire unable to come out and stand tall over and over again."
